
Six Bayern players have been named in Germany’s preliminary 27-man squad for Euro 2024 in Germany this summer in Manuel Neuer, Joshua Kimmich, Aleksandar Pavlovic, Jamal Musiala, Leroy Sane and Thomas M üller.

Opening game in Munich on 14 June
Julian Nagelsmann’s team have two warm-up matches before they kick off the tournament against Scotland in Munich on 14 June. Neuer & Co. will face Ukraine in Nuremberg on 3 June before hosting Greece in Mönchengladbach three days later. The squad will be reduced to between 23 and 26 players by 7 June.
France and Netherlands announce squads
Bayern duo Dayot Upamecano and Kingsley Coman have been named in France’s final 25-man squad by Didier Deschamps. Munich defender Matthijs de Ligt has been included in the 30-player provisional squad by Netherlands boss Ronald Koeman, which will be reduced by four by 29 May.
